The Basics of Betting Odds
Betting odds represent the likelihood of a particular outcome occurring in a sporting event. They serve several purposes, including determining how much a player stands to win if their bet is successful. Odds can be displayed in various formats, such as decimal, fractional, or American odds. Understanding these formats is crucial for effective betting.
- Decimal odds: This format indicates the total returns on a winning bet, including the stake. For example, if the odds are 2.00, a $10 bet would return $20 total, which includes the initial stake.
- Fractional odds: Commonly used in the UK, these odds represent the profit relative to the stake. Odds of 5/1 mean that for every $1 bet, a player would win $5.
- American odds: This system uses positive or negative numbers to show how much you can win on a $100 stake. Positive odds show the profit, while negative odds indicate how much you need to bet to win $100.
Different Types of Wagers in Sports Betting
Understanding different types of wagers is vital for strategizing effectively. Some common types include:
- Moneyline bets
- Point spread bets: A wager on the margin of victory, leveling the playing field between teams. A favorite must win by a certain number of points, while an underdog can still win if they lose by a specific margin.
- Over/Under (Totals) bets: Bets placed on whether the total points scored in a game will be over or under a specified amount.
- Prop bets: Given on specific events within the game, such as player performance or special occurrences.
How keo nha cai Works and Its Importance
Understanding how keo nha cai operates is key to successful sports betting. It reflects public perception and how bookmakers adjust odds based on betting patterns. Bookmakers aim to balance the action on both sides of a wager, ensuring they make a profit regardless of the outcome. This means staying informed about team news, injury reports, and other variables affecting a game can provide bettors with an edge.

Bankroll Management Essentials
Effective bankroll management is crucial for any gambler looking to maintain a healthy betting experience. Here are some essential strategies:
- Set a budget: Determine how much you are willing to spend on gambling and stick to it.
- Use a flat betting strategy: Bet the same amount on each wager to minimize potential losses.
- Risk management: Avoid betting more than 1-5% of your total bankroll on a single event.

Common Mistakes to Avoid in Sports Betting
Chasing Losses: Why It’s Dangerous
One significant pitfall in sports betting is chasing losses—betting larger amounts to recover lost money. This can lead to even bigger losses and a detrimental cycle that may impact your finances. Always stick to your betting strategy and avoid emotional decision-making.
Neglecting Research and Analysis
Relying on luck rather than thorough analysis can result in unfavorable outcomes. Always conduct research before making wagers. Understanding team performance, player injuries, and historical data can guide more informed and potentially profitable betting decisions.
Ignoring Bankroll Limits and Self-Control
Establishing and adhering to gambling limits is essential for maintaining control over your betting activities. This includes setting time limits on sessions and being mindful of how much you wager. Self-exclusion programs and seeking help for gambling problems are also valuable resources if needed.
